2 Replies Latest reply on Apr 29, 2003 10:25 AM by östen

    Setting pool size for Oracle XA source?

    östen

      Howdy!

      Does anyone know how to set the pool size for an Oracle XA data source?

      Are there a DTD for the oracle-xa-ds.xml anywhere??

      Peace!

      /Östen

        • 1. Re: Setting pool size for Oracle XA source?
          davidjencks

          <!--pooling parameters-->
          <min-pool-size>5</min-pool-size>
          <max-pool-size>100</max-pool-size>
          <blocking-timeout-millis>5000</blocking-timeout-millis>
          <idle-timeout-minutes>15</idle-timeout-minutes>

          • 2. Re: Setting pool size for Oracle XA source?
            östen

            Thanx!

            I am using this:


            <xa-datasource>
            <jndi-name>DefaultDS</jndi-name>
            <track-connection-by-tx>true</track-connection-by-tx>
            <isSameRM-override-value>false</isSameRM-override-value>

            <managedconnectionfactory-class>org.jboss.resource.adapter.jdbc.xa.oracle.XAOracleManagedConnectionFactory</managedconnectionfactory-class>
            <xa-datasource-class>oracle.jdbc.xa.client.OracleXADataSource</xa-datasource-class>
            <xa-datasource-property name="URL">jdbc:oracle:thin:@222.222.222.222:1521:XXXXX</xa-datasource-property>
            <xa-datasource-property name="User">xxx</xa-datasource-property>
            <xa-datasource-property name="Password">xxx</xa-datasource-property>

            <min-pool-size>0</min-pool-size>
            <max-pool-size>50</max-pool-size>
            <blocking-timeout-millis>20000</blocking-timeout-millis>
            <idle-timeout-minutes>15</idle-timeout-minutes>

            <exception-sorter-class-name>org.jboss.resource.adapter.jdbc.vendor.OracleExceptionSorter</exception-sorter-class-name>
            </xa-datasource>

            <!--

            <depends optional-attribute-name="TransactionManagerService">jboss.tm:service=TransactionManagerService

            -->



            .. and it seems to work....

            /Östen